Montana Winfield seems to have everything,charisma, fame and a chair in Dickens at a fine university.
But he is so driven by it all, that the wife he adores leaves him.
When a stranger knocks on the door late that night with a lost Dickens manuscript, she brings with it a secret about herself.
Reading the Dickens story and talking with the young woman changes Montana forever.
The Montana story alternates with scenes from the Dickens novel (invented by the playwright).
Unit set.
Approximate running time: 2 hours.
Inventing Montana is a American comedy play written by Jeanne Murray Walker and published by Dramatic Publishing (2002).
